The center of gravity of a right angled triangle having h as height and b as base length and vertex at 90 degrees is at origin.

(a) (h/3,b/3)

(b) (b/4,h/4)

(c) (b/3,h/3)

(d) (h/2,b/2)

Correct answer is (c) (b/3,h/3)

Easy explanation: Given is a right angled triangle having h as height and b as base length and vertex at 90 degrees is at origin. The center of gravity coincides with the centroid of the triangle the given answer is the centroid for such a triangle.
